`
岁月如歌
  • 浏览: 106476 次
  • 性别: Icon_minigender_1
  • 来自: 成都
社区版块
存档分类
最新评论

国际化中网页建议用utf-8编码

阅读更多

国际化中网页建议用utf-8编码

 

    使用UTF-8编码唯一的好处是,国外的用户如果使用Windows XP英文版,浏览UTF-8编码的任何网页,无论是中文、还是日文、韩文、阿拉伯文,都可以正常显示,UTF-8是世界通用的语言编码,UTF-8的推广要归功于Google的应用,以及Blog开发者。而如果用Windows XP英文版的IE6.0浏览gb2312语言编码的网页,则会提示是否安装语言包。因此,可能会失去很多的国外浏览者。

    使用gb2312编码的好处是,因为程序产生的网页文本使用ANSI编码格式,会比UTF-8文本编码节省一些体积,访问速度会稍微快一点点,大约是30:38的比例,也就是30K的ANSI编码,转为UTF-8编码是38K,当然,这个比例并不准确,是会随Unicode字符集区域的不同而变化的。

分享到:
评论

相关推荐

    php网页中utf-8编码转换gb2312实用类

    在PHP编程中,字符编码是处理网页内容时一个至关重要的环节。UTF-8和GB2312是中国简体中文常用的两种编码格式,各有其特点...同时,随着互联网技术的发展,建议尽可能使用国际化的UTF-8编码,以应对未来的兼容性挑战。

    百度编辑器ueditor-1.4.3.3 utf8-net 和 ueditor-1.4.3.2 gbk-net

    utf-8编码对于多语言支持有着显著优势,因此,如果你的项目需要面对全球用户或包含大量非中文内容,这个版本将是理想的选择。同时,版本号1.4.3.3表明这是一个较新的版本,可能包含更多的功能更新和修复的bug,确保...

    基于PHP的小刀php网站自动收录 UTF-8.zip

    2. 采用UTF-8编码,支持处理多语言内容,适应全球化需求。 3. 可能利用了PHP的HTTP客户端功能来抓取网页,如cURL库。 4. 可能使用了正则表达式或DOM解析器来解析和提取网页内容。 5. 可能涉及数据库操作,用于存储和...

    JS失效 提示HTML1114: (UNICODE 字节顺序标记)的代码页 utf-8 覆盖(META 标记)的冲突的代码页 utf-8

    对于开发环境,建议使用UTF-8作为统一的编码标准,因为它是国际化的,并且大多数现代编辑器默认支持这一标准。同时,确保编辑器保存文件时不会添加BOM,因为某些浏览器可能对BOM处理不当。 在实际开发中,如果你...

    php+jquery编码方面的一些心得(utf-8 gb2312)

    而在前端jQuery处理方面,客户端的网页应该统一使用UTF-8编码格式。这一点可以通过HTML文档的meta标签来指定: ```html <meta http-equiv="content-type" content="text/html; charset=utf-8"/> ``` 设置正确的...

    关于中jsp乱码的问题

    charset=UTF-8" %>`指令,确保整个页面使用UTF-8编码。 - **IDE设置**:确保你的IDE(如Eclipse、IntelliJ IDEA)的文件编码设置为UTF-8,防止源代码保存时产生编码问题。 - **服务器配置**:在Tomcat等服务器的...

    JSP、SERVLET_中的汉字编码问.txt

    - 这样可以确保JSP页面的内容是以UTF-8编码发送到客户端的。 2. **表单提交处理**: - 在客户端表单提交时,确保表单元素中包含正确的字符编码: ```html <form action="/submit" method="post" accept-charset=...

    pw9.0重庆社区风格

    文件名称列表中的"UTF-8"和"GBK",很可能是两个子目录或者压缩文件,分别包含了采用UTF-8编码和GBK编码的模板文件。用户解压后会看到两个不同的文件夹,每个文件夹下有对应编码格式的所有模板文件。在实际应用中,...

    多种语言(big5\gbk\gb2312\utf8\Shift_JIS\iso8859-1)的网页编码切换解决方案归纳

    最后,为了保持开发和维护的统一性,建议JSP和JAVA文件都采用utf-8编码方式,数据库也应使用utf-8编码,这是在多语言网页设计中非常关键的一个步骤。 综上所述,实现多种语言的网页编码切换解决方案需要综合考虑...

    Jsp乱码解决方案 word文档

    2. **修改服务器配置**:在Tomcat的`server.xml`文件中,找到`Connector`标签,添加`URIEncoding="UTF-8"`属性,确保服务器接收请求时使用UTF-8编码。 3. **处理请求参数**:对于POST请求,需要在Servlet或Filter中...

    PHP实例开发源码-发现世界搜索引擎 php版GBK版.zip

    在该实例中,开发者可能采用了GBK编码,GBK是中国大陆广泛使用的汉字编码标准,它兼容GB2312,能容纳更多的中文字符,但在处理多语言环境时可能会遇到问题,因为UTF-8编码已成为国际化的标准。 源码分析: 1. **...

    怎么在.js文件里写中文注释

    1. **选择合适的字符编码**:在编写包含中文注释的 JavaScript 文件时,建议使用 UTF-8 编码。UTF-8 是目前最常用的字符编码之一,它可以很好地支持包括中文在内的各种语言。 - **配置文件编码**:如果你使用的是 ...

    phpcms-utf版-9.6

    5. **多语言支持**:UTF编码确保了对多语言的支持,便于构建国际化网站。 6. **内容采编流程**:支持内容的采编审流程,确保信息发布的准确性。 7. **广告管理**:内置广告管理系统,方便添加、管理和投放各种形式...

    http_encoding_recommendations.pdf

    ### HTTP编码推荐知识点详解 #### 一、概述 在探讨HTTP编码推荐之前,我们首先需要了解几个基础概念:HTTP协议、字符...在未来的发展中,随着国际化程度的加深和技术的进步,正确处理字符编码将成为更加关键的一环。

    页面编码codepage=936和65001的区别

    在网页编码中使用UTF-8编码可以确保页面内容的国际化,避免了字符编码不一致导致的乱码问题。 当我们在ASP等服务器端脚本中使用 <%@codepage=936%> 时,即是告诉服务器,当前的页面内容是用简体中文编码的,服务器...

    ajax中文乱码问题解决方案

    7. **统一编码标准**:尽管GBK编码在中国大陆比较常见,但为了更好的兼容性和国际化,建议尽可能地使用UTF-8作为统一的编码标准,以减少乱码问题。 总之,解决Ajax中文乱码问题的关键在于确保前端、后端、请求和...

    ckeditor与ckfinder整合forJAVA(支持文件上传、解决乱码问题)二

    整合CKEditor与CKFinder for Java的过程中,关键在于确保整个系统能够支持Unicode编码,特别是UTF-8编码。这不仅有助于解决中文乱码的问题,还能提高整个项目的国际化水平。此外,通过配置和优化Tomcat服务器,能够...

    Java中的字符编码问题处理心得总结

    Java的String类默认使用Unicode编码,这是国际化的基础,Unicode包含了世界上几乎所有的字符集,包括常用的UTF-8编码,这是一种变长编码,对于ASCII字符只用1字节表示,而对于其他字符可能需要2至4字节。 在Java中...

    考试试题集锦考试试题集锦

    - `<?xml version="1.0"?>` 没有指定编码,但通常应该以 UTF-8 编码保存,这是国际化的标准。 - `<?xml version="1.0" encoding="UTF-8"?>` 表示文件应使用 UTF-8 编码保存。 - `...

Global site tag (gtag.js) - Google Analytics